Google changes app links, fees in new move to follow EU gatekeeper law

By Lewis Crofts ( August 19, 2025, 17:17 GMT | Insight) -- Google has eased restrictions on how app developers link out to offers outside of the company’s Play Store, and adapted its fee structure, in the latest moved designed to comply with the EU’s flagship digital gatekeeper law.
